What Does DGAF Stand For?
DGAF stands for "Don't Give a F**k." It is a blunt expression used to convey apathy or indifference toward a particular situation, person, or event. The term has gained popularity due to its straightforward and unfiltered nature, resonating with those who prefer direct communication.
While the literal translation may seem harsh, the phrase often serves as a humorous or lighthearted way to express disinterest. Understanding the context in which DGAF is used is essential to avoid misinterpretation.
The Origin of DGAF
The exact origin of DGAF is difficult to pinpoint, but its roots can be traced back to internet culture and online forums. The term likely emerged as a shortened version of the longer phrase "I don't give a fuck," which has been used in various forms since the early 2000s.
How DGAF Gained Popularity
DGAF's rise in popularity coincided with the growth of social media platforms like Twitter, Instagram, and TikTok. These platforms provided a space for users to share memes, jokes, and commentary using acronyms like DGAF to convey complex emotions in a concise manner.
How to Use DGAF Appropriately
Using DGAF appropriately requires an understanding of the audience and context. Below are some guidelines for incorporating DGAF into your communication:
- Use DGAF in casual or informal settings, such as text messages or social media posts.
- Avoid using DGAF in professional or formal environments, as it may come across as disrespectful.
- Be mindful of the recipient's sensitivity to profanity, as DGAF contains a strong expletive.
